Where each one falls short
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.
Auth0
- Free tier limited to 25,000 monthly active users, requiring upgrade for growth beyond that
- Advanced features like MFA and RBAC only available on paid Essentials tier and above
- Ownership by Okta introduces risk that independent product roadmap may change
Zabbix Cloud
- Billed by NVPS (new values per second) rather than by number of monitored hosts, so cost scales with metric volume: Nano starts at $50/month for 50 NVPS and 2xLarge reaches $5,000/month for 10,000 NVPS
- The free trial lasts only 5 days before a paid subscription is required
- Annual subscription is needed to get the 10% discount; the base prices listed are monthly rates

Answered from the vendors’ own pages
Auth0: How much does Auth0 cost?
Auth0 has a Free tier for up to 25,000 monthly active users (MAUs). Paid plans start at $35/month (Essentials B2C) and scale to $240/month (Professional B2C) and higher for Enterprise. Pricing scales with MAU usage.
SourceZabbix Cloud: What is the starting price for Zabbix Cloud?
Zabbix Cloud starts at $50 per month for the Nano tier, which includes 50 NVPS and 10GB of free storage. Pricing scales up to $5000 monthly for the 2xLarge tier with 10000 NVPS.
SourceAuth0: Does Auth0 include Multi-Factor Authentication?
No. MFA, RBAC (Role-Based Access Control), and premium support are not included in the free tier and require upgrading to paid Essentials plans or higher.
SourceZabbix Cloud: Is there a free trial for Zabbix Cloud?
Yes, Zabbix Cloud offers a 5-day free trial with no credit card required. After the trial, you save 10% by converting to an annual subscription.
SourceAuth0: Is Auth0 independent or part of a larger company?
Auth0 was acquired by Okta in May 2021 for $6.5 billion. It now operates as a subsidiary business unit within Okta, but maintains its own brand and operations.
SourceZabbix Cloud: How does annual billing work with Zabbix Cloud?
Annual subscribers receive a 10% discount on monthly pricing. A pricing calculator is available to estimate costs based on devices, metrics, update intervals, and storage requirements.
SourceAuth0: Who should use Auth0 vs Okta?
Auth0 is developer-focused and serves customer identity use cases (B2C). Okta serves workforce identity (B2B) and has broader enterprise features. Auth0 now serves both markets post-acquisition but maintains its developer-friendly positioning.
